Borussia Dortmund knocked Atlético down and reached semi-finals

Borussia Dortmund qualified for the semi-finals of the Champions League, by hosting and beating Atlético de Madrid, 4-2, which allowed them to overturn the defeat they suffered in the duel. of the first leg of the 'quarters', at Civitas Metropolitano, by 2-1.

Faced with a Signal Iduna Park 'bursting at the seams', the German team produced a truly 'diabolical' first half, and took the lead after 34 minutes, thanks to a well-aimed shot by Julian Brandt.

Just five minutes later, Ian Maatsen completed the 'somersault' in the tie.

Just four minutes after returning from the dressing room, Mats Hummels put the ball in his own goal.

In the 64th minute, it was Ángel Correa's turn, to give the Spaniards reason to celebrate... but not for long, as Niclas Fullkrug and Marcel Sabitzer then scored, to sentence, from a once and for all, qualification for the next phase.
